Flatbed screen printing can be considered an automated version of the older hand-operated silkscreen printing process used on t-shirts, sweatshirts, and other printed items. For each colour in the print design, a separate screen must be constructed or engraved.There are three common types of screen printing presses: flat-bed, cylinder, and rotary.Other cons of screen printing include: more limited colour ranges available. the amount of ink used can make the design look as if it is raised from the print material. it cannot be customised in the manner of digital printing.In a busy work environment, you'll need to find a large space sufficient to house not only the printer but also to allow the printed material to feed through as well.Screen printing is a popular printing method, using a process that presses ink through a mesh screen in order to create a printed design. It's used in a huge range of industries across the globe to create custom clothing, canvasses, artwork, posters, and more.Using a stencil, or a series of stencils, the ink is distributed to the desired area(s) by being pressed through a porous screen, hence the name Screen Printing. Also known as silkscreen, serigraph, or serigraph printing, Screen Printing can be performed as a manual or automated process.Spot Colour Screen Printing.
